The fatal lightning strike highlights the ongoing risks posed by severe weather, particularly in areas prone to thunderstorms. While the odds of being struck are low, lightning can cause fatalities and injuries, with nearly 90% of victims surviving such incidents. This year alone, eight lightning-related deaths have been reported in the U.S., with Florida accounting for two of these fatalities. The tragedy underscores the importance of taking precautions during storms, especially in open areas where the risk of being struck is higher.
